On Monday, February 06, 2012 10:44:09 AM Gavin Andresen wrote: > There are several major changes in git HEAD that are ready for wider > testing. The best way of getting lots of testing is to release > binaries, so I'm going to be pulling together a release candidate in > the next day or two.
There are still many other pull requests that seem to be ready, but perhaps those can just as well wait for 0.7 if the 0.6 changes are deemed too much to add onto. Here are some that seem to be well-tested, and have been part of next-test for a while: 719 coinbaser (already verbally accepted by Gavin for 0.6 a while ago!) 568 rpc_keepalive 565 optimize_FastGetWork 715 bugfix_client_name 562 optimize_ToHex > 769 : Make transactions with extra data in scriptSig non-standard If this affects relaying, it will significantly harm the ability to replace the current spammy "green address" scheme with a sensible extra signature system. On the miner end, it could significantly harm adoption of such a system. > Pull a modified version of: > 755 : Don't vote for /P2SH/ unless -p2sh specified What else do I need to change for this? > I'd like to pull 787 (CAddrMan: stochastic address manager) but it > didn't pass my sanity tests. I can also confirm I have seen at least one addr.db corruption with this.
